How do I keep my shower curtain from coming off the hook?

Thread one of the hooks through each hole in the curtain. Frequently there won’t be enough hooks in the pack to have one in each hole of the shower curtain. Adding additional hooks will distribute the weight of the curtain more easily, helping it stay up.
